FCP-03 documents practical synchrony methods for teams operating under split attention, noise, and unstable conditions.

The manual focuses on shared cadence, rapid alignment checks, and drift correction that can be applied in field operations, facilitation settings, and high-pressure coordination work.

Its central claim is procedural: coherence can be trained and reproduced through timing discipline.

What This Manual Covers
  • Cadence drills for maintaining shared timing
  • Call-and-response routines for fast alignment
  • Micro-agreement protocols to prevent group drift
  • Handoff timing in noisy or disrupted environments
  • Breath, pause, and gaze synchronization techniques
  • Reset and recovery procedures after desynchronization
Operational Use Cases

FCP-03 is relevant for:

  • Crisis response teams
  • Mediators and facilitators
  • Instructional teams and trainers
  • Small units working in high-noise conditions
  • Operators responsible for keeping group tempo coherent
